This is all looking good, I like the battery relocation, and it's something I want to do with mine, and tips ? as I use my car daily for work, and want the battery in the spare wheel well, or near it.

I take it cars not stripped out at all you would have to run it down the right hand side of the car pretty much the same as if you was to put a amp power lead In just need new battery tray and junction box to connect and if you want a braker and a kill switch in place simple to do but bits work out pretty dear just to move a battery
